INSPECTION




  • Check the cylinder for wear, damage or rust.
  • Check the piston surface for wear, damage or rust.
  • Check the caliper body or sleeve for wear.
  • Check the pad for damage or adhesion of grease, check the backing metal for damage.

PAD WEAR CHECK


warning
  • Always replace both brake pads on each wheel as a set. Failure to do so will result in uneven braking, which may cause unreliable brake operation.
  • If there is significant difference in the thickness of the pads on the left and right sides, check the sliding condition of the piston and slide pins.

1.Measure thickness at the thinnest and most worn area of the pad.
Standard value: 10.0 mm
Minimum limit: 2.0 mm
2.Replace the pad assembly if pad thickness is less than the limit value.
